Beech House, South Chingford
Built in neo-Georgian style in 1937 to the designs of architect Arthur Mayston. Information extracted from: The Buildings of England. London 5: East. New Haven, London : Yale University Press, 2005, p. 722. Built as a Home of Rest for women. Converted to residential accommodation.

Church of St Edmund, South Chingford
Built 1938/1939 to the designs of architect N.F. Cachemaille-Day. Information extracted from: The Buildings of England. London 5: East. New Haven, London : Yale University Press, 2005, p. 713. The church is Grade II listed, described at this https://historicengland.org.uk/listing/the-list/list-entry/1191122.
